Consulting development program (CDP)

This program is focused on our consultative business areas involving health care process, operations, product and technology. In addition to challenging assignments, we lean heavily on networking and mentoring, and interface with high levels of leadership.

What we are looking for

We are a highly matrixed organization that requires you to solve for ambiguity in many of your role responsibilities. You will wear many hats in this position by providing end-to-end consulting services and serving as a subject matter expert on various functions and work streams.

  • You should have a post-graduation degree/diploma or be nearing completion in a business related field.
  • Strong teamwork, collaboration and solid communication skills are essential.
  • We seek people who are highly flexible and have an aptitude to work in a consultative environment.
  • You should be very comfortable working in a performance-oriented culture that requires a high level of personal drive and self-direction.
